Franklin Industries Board of Directors

Get the latest insights into the leadership at Franklin Industries. Learn about the experienced professionals guiding the company's strategy and governance.

NamePosition
Mr. Maheshkumar Jethabhai Patel Managing Director
Mr. Ashishkumar Jayantilal Kapadiya Non Executive Director
Mr. Peeyush Sethia Independent Director
Ms. Apra Sharma Independent Director
